site stats

Flushrealtimeservice

WebFor data storage, RocketMQ uses the file programming model. In order to improve the writing performance of files, the memory mapping mechanism is usually introduced. The data is written to the page cache first, and then the page cache data is flushed to the disk. The performance and data reliabUTF-8... WebWhat is the purpose of the change Increase RocketMQ code coverage Brief changelog modify DefaultMessageStoreTest.java, cover FlushRealTimeService Verifying this …

org.apache.rocketmq.store.CommitLog$FlushRealTimeService.getServiceName ...

WebJun 17, 2024 · 异步刷盘. 异步刷盘根据是否开启transientStorePoolEnable 机制,刷盘实现会有细微差别。如果transientStorePoolEnable 为true , RocketMQ 会单独申请一个与目标物理文件( commitlog)同样大小的堆外内存, 该堆外内存将使用内存锁定,确保不会被置换到虚拟内存中去,消息首先追加到堆外内存,然后提交到与物理 ... Web为了使问题描述的更加清楚,我就在此使用中文啦。 FlushRealTimeService中lastFlushTimestamp的用法有一些问题,lastFlushTimestamp应该 ... imav consulting + us https://danasaz.com

rocketmq之消息同步与异步刷盘学习笔记 - 简书

WebBUG REPORT 在RocketMQ运行过程中,将FlushDiskType从ASYNC_FLUSH修改为SYNC_FLUSH时,系统出错。 java.lang.ClassCastException: … WebSep 7, 2024 · 我们发现异步刷盘的时候有两种方式,一种是堆外内存池开启时启动CommitRealTimeService服务线程,另一个是默认执行的FlushRealTimeService服务线 … im available for the meeting

RocketMQ Source Analysis Message Storage

Category:【RocketMQ】三种刷盘策略分析 - 掘金 - 稀土掘金

Tags:Flushrealtimeservice

Flushrealtimeservice

Amazon.com: FLUSHTIME Septic Tank Treatment 12 …

WebNov 9, 2024 · FlushRealTimeService: asynchronous disk flushing thread of out of heap memory is not enabled. As shown in the following figure, after the message is written to the Page Cache, the message processing thread immediately returns and asynchronously swipes the disk through the FlushRealTimeService. WebThis introduces the three thread brushing services described in this article, FlushRealTimeService, CommitRealTimeService, and GroupCommitService. GroupCommitService. After the broker starts, it will start many service threads, including the flushing service thread. If the flushing service thread type is SYNC_FLUSH (synchronous …

Flushrealtimeservice

Did you know?

WebJun 23, 2024 · 前文有简单的提到 RocketMQ 的底层文件存储模型,基于该存储模型之上再简单的探索一下 CommitLog 的一个底层设计,思考 RocketMQ 如何做到高性能?. 对于 … Web1) Set the message save time to the current timestamp, set the CRC inspection code. 2) If it is a delay message, change Topic to schedule_topic_xxxx, and back up the original Topic and QueueID. 3) Get the last mappedfile of CommitLog, then add a write message lock. 4) If MappedFile is full, create a new one.

WebAug 10, 2024 · public void warmMappedFile(FlushDiskType type, int pages) { long beginTime = System.currentTimeMillis(); ByteBuffer byteBuffer = this.mappedByteBuffer.slice(); int flush = 0; long time = System.currentTimeMillis(); for (int i = 0, j = 0; i = pages) { flush = i; mappedByteBuffer.force(); } } if (j % 1000 == 0) { … WebThe broker in the rocketMq is to process the producer to send a message request, the consumer consumes the message request, and the message is persisted, as well as the HA policy and the server-side filtering, that is, the heavy work in the cluster is handed over to the broker for processing.

WebHelper function to flush resource streaming. Web1、消息存储概述. RocketMQ 的存储文件,放在 ${ROCKET_HOME}/store 目录下。. 当生产者发送消息时,broker 会将消息存储到 commit 文件下,然后再异步的转存到 consumeQueue 以及 indexFile。. commitlog 消息主体以及元数据的存储主体。Producer 发送的消息就存放在 commitlog 里面.. consumeQueue 消息消费队列,引入的目的 ...

WebCooling System Flush. Costs on average $190.77 - $233.16. Parts cost on average $31.47 - $38.46, and services cost $159.30 - $194.70. This repair takes on average 1.35h - 1.65h for a mechanic to complete. The skill level required for this repair is intermediate expertise required. Home.

WebThis introduces the three thread brushing services described in this article, FlushRealTimeService, CommitRealTimeService, and GroupCommitService. … im a very good bad boy songWebUse GroupCommitService when synchronizing the brush Use FlushRealTimeService when asynchronously brushing If you op... RocketMq-synchronous replication and asynchronous replication Synchronous replication and asynchronous replication If a Broker group has Master and Slave, messages need to be replicated from Master to Slave. ima van gogh exhibitWebNov 7, 2024 · 这里讲解CommitLog内部类FlushCommitLogService以及其实现类CommitRealTimeService,FlushRealTimeService,GroupCommitService,用于处理刷盘 … list of housing projects in nashvilleWebNov 2, 2024 · 1. 如果是同步刷盘,那么获取同步刷盘服务GroupCommitService:1.1同步等待:如果消息的配置需要等待存储完成后才返回,那么构建同步刷盘请求,并且将请求 … im a very relaxed student paragraphWebMar 1, 2024 · Amazon.com: FLUSHTIME Septic Tank Treatment 12 Month Supply Avoid Septic Backup Monthly Preventive Septic Maintenance … list of housing legislation ukWebCooling System Flush. Costs on average $190.77 - $233.16. Parts cost on average $31.47 - $38.46, and services cost $159.30 - $194.70. This repair takes on average 1.35h - 1.65h for a mechanic to complete. The skill level required for this repair is intermediate expertise required. Home. list of housing providers birminghamWebThe following examples show how to use org.apache.rocketmq.store.config.FlushDiskType.You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. imav football